Austin Butler Wore Ferragamo & Prada During Palm Springs International Film Festival

It’s been a busy start of the year for Austin Butler who has already served up three looks in a week.

The ‘Elvis’ star collected his Breakthrough Performance Award at the Palm Springs International Film Festival wearing a Ferragamo suit.

My eyes fell immediately on the blazer, as sculpted this piece with the meticulous lines showcase Maximilian Davis’ scrupulous eye and design expertise. 

With striking peak satin lapels this is a classic silhouette was realised in the highest degree.

Jimmy Choo shoes and Cartier jewels completed his look. 

For the Variety’s Creative Impact Awards and 10 Directors To Watch Brunch held in Palm Springs, California, the actor wore a Prada grey pinstripe single-breasted suit with a white poplin smoking shirt.

If I wasn’t so enamoured by the cut and fabrics on the first look, I might have been more excited about the sharpness of this Prada outing.

But to be fair to this look, it was worn for a day time event where he was honoured.

Now this is more like it. And I’m not just referring to the open, sheer shirt. Although I won’t lie, that plays a part in selling this look.

Honestly, the black on black pinstripes and the relaxed elegance of this Celine Homme look made me swoon when I first saw Austin on Jimmy Kimmel Live, where he talked about his film and preparing to play the iconic musician.

He also spoke about the difficulties he faced whilst working with Quentin Tarantino, his upcoming appearance at the Golden Globes, and so much more.

Celine has always been a great brand for Austin both structurally and sartorially.
